Pricing Strategies and Their Impact

Pricing strategies are pivotal in determining a property's time on the market and its ultimate success in Cambridge's dynamic real estate landscape. Here's a breakdown of some key pricing strategies and their impact:

  • Competitive Pricing: Setting a competitive price based on thorough market analysis can attract more potential buyers and generate higher interest in the property.
  • Overpricing: Pricing a property too high can deter potential buyers, resulting in extended listing periods and potentially necessitating price reductions.
  • Underpricing: While underpricing may attract quick offers, it can leave money on the table and lead to questions about the property's value.
  • Strategic Pricing Adjustments: Monitoring market conditions and adjusting the price strategically can help keep the listing competitive and responsive to buyer feedback.
  • Perception of Value: The listing price influences buyers' perception of the property's value, affecting their willingness to make offers and negotiate terms.

Implementing an effective pricing strategy requires careful consideration of market dynamics, property characteristics, and seller objectives to maximize the property's appeal and expedite the sales process in Cambridge.

Effects of Prolonged Listing Periods

Prolonged listing periods can have significant consequences for sellers in the Cambridge property market, impacting their financial bottom line and emotional well-being. Here are some effects of extended market presence:

  • Decreased Buyer Interest: A property that remains on the market for an extended period may deter potential buyers, who may perceive it as undesirable or overpriced.
  • Price Erosion: Prolonged listing periods often lead to price reductions as sellers attempt to attract buyers, potentially resulting in lower sale proceeds.
  • Increased Carrying Costs: Maintaining a property on the market for an extended duration incurs ongoing expenses such as mortgage payments, property taxes, and utilities, adding to the financial burden for sellers.
  • Seller Fatigue: The stress and uncertainty of prolonged listing periods can affect sellers' emotional well-being, leading to frustration, anxiety, and fatigue.
  • Perception of Property Flaws: Lingering on the market may create the perception among buyers that there are underlying issues with the property, further deterring interest.
  • Difficulty Negotiating Favorable Terms: As time passes, sellers may find themselves in a weaker negotiating position, potentially compromising on terms such as price, contingencies, and closing timelines.
